Corporate-law firm BHSM LLP has appointed Sarah O’Toole as a partner.
She joined the firm in 2014 as a solicitor, and works with two of its departments: litigation and dispute-resolution, and insolvency and corporate restructuring.
O’Toole’s main area of practice is commercial disputes involving corporations and private clients, typically in the High Court and Commercial Court
The firm says that she has extensive experience in property and construction-related disputes, and advises commercial landlords and tenants on a wide range of issues.
She also has experience in relation to advising multi-national companies, and has worked with law firms in other jurisdictions on a range of multi-jurisdictional disputes.
Mark Homan (managing partner) said that the appointment illustrated the firm’s ambitions for growth.
